1805 Grand Ave, Glenwood Spgs, CO 81601-4111

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 81601:
28 Ponderosa Dr, Glenwood Spgs, CO 81601-2655
1304 Colorado Ct, Glenwood Spgs, CO 81601-4104
4011 Sky Ranch Dr, Glenwood Spgs, CO 81601-9277
1201 Riverview Dr, Glenwood Spgs, CO 81601-3248
66 Woodruff Pl, Glenwood Spgs, CO 81601-9423